Tell me why you think our Constitution should protect, by requiring a higher vote to reduce it, this tax expenditure, this tax credit for child care for wealthy people but not protect the appropriation needed to provide child care for people of limited means?
Said by
Dick Durbin
Democratic · Illinois

Editor's note · Context

Durbin challenges the unequal protection of tax credits for wealthy versus appropriations for low-income families.
